Study with Quizlet and memorize flashcards containing terms like The correct answer is A. Standing behind him and using a transfer belt protects both the client and the aide., The correct answer is B. Urinary retention refers to an inability to urinate. Retention of urine is a symptom that should be reported to the charge nurse as soon as it is noted., The correct answer is A. Because of this ...48 of 48. The 60 questions in this Certified Nursing Assistant Exam Simulator have been divided among the domains, or categories, in the same way the actual 2024 CNA examination is constructed: Basic Nursing Skills and Safety/Emergency Procedures: 39%. Personal Care Skills: 14%. Mental Health and Social Services Needs: 11%.
